Neighborhood Overview

AMF Van Wyck Lanes is situated in the bustling Richmond Hill neighborhood of Queens, offering a vibrant local atmosphere. The venue is easily accessible via major thoroughfares like Metropolitan Avenue and Van Wyck Expressway, putting it within reach of many parts of the borough and beyond. For those arriving by air, John F. Kennedy International Airport (JFK) is the closest major airport, typically a 20-30 minute drive depending on traffic. LaGuardia Airport (LGA) is also relatively accessible, usually around a 25-35 minute drive. Public transportation is a viable option, with numerous MTA bus lines serving Metropolitan Avenue and surrounding streets, providing connections to subway lines that can take you throughout New York City. Rideshare services are readily available, though surge pricing can occur during peak hours. Smart arrival tactics involve aiming for off-peak times if possible, or allowing ample buffer for navigating city traffic, especially on weekends or during evening league play.

Forest Park

1.5 mi

One of Queens’ largest parks, Forest Park offers a vast natural escape with extensive wooded areas, walking and biking trails, and various recreational facilities. Visitors can explore historic pathways, enjoy picnicking spots, or visit the Forest Park Carousel. It’s an excellent destination for those seeking more active outdoor pursuits or a longer period of relaxation amidst nature, just a short drive from the bowling alley.

Jamaica Performing Arts Center (JPAC)

1.6 mi

Located in the heart of Jamaica, JPAC is a cultural gem that hosts a variety of performances, exhibitions, and community events. If your visit aligns with a show, it can offer an evening of entertainment and artistic appreciation. Even outside of scheduled events, the center’s presence signifies the cultural vibrancy of the surrounding Jamaica neighborhood, which also boasts a wide array of shopping and dining options.

Dagu Rice Noodle

1.5 mi

Situated in the heart of Flushing, a short drive or subway ride away, Dagu Rice Noodle offers a popular and distinctive culinary experience. Known for its flavorful noodle soups served in traditional clay pots, it provides a unique and warming meal. It’s a great spot for a group looking to try something different and enjoy a hearty, satisfying dish after a few games of bowling.

Local & Elevated Picks

Ayada Thai Restaurant

2.0 mi

Ayada Thai in Elmhurst is a highly-regarded establishment known for its authentic and flavorful Thai cuisine. They offer a wide range of traditional dishes, from spicy curries to fresh stir-fries, prepared with high-quality ingredients. It’s an excellent choice for groups seeking a more refined dining experience with vibrant flavors, providing a delicious contrast to the casual fun of bowling.

Adda Indian Canteen

2.5 mi

Recognized for its innovative approach to Indian street food and classic dishes, Adda in Long Island City offers a lively atmosphere and bold flavors. The menu features creative twists on familiar Indian fare, making it an exciting spot for a group looking for a memorable culinary adventure. It’s a bit further afield but offers a distinct and highly-rated dining experience.
